My console history

Just thought I'd give you some info before you judge me as a microsoft fanboy.

C64 - Yes, that's where it all started... it wasn't mine, but my cousin's. I spent countless hours I can't remember in front of that thing, can't even remember what it looks like now...
NES - My first console. Started off with a little SMB, but soon got a taste for MM and TMNT. Also played some T&T, NWC, BM and in later years FF.
SNES - Again, another console I've spent a lot of time with, but wasn't actually my own. A few of my all time favorites are on this console, like SMW.
PS1 - My second console. The PS1 has so many classics, I don't know where to begin. This console is also where my favorite game was released, FFVII.
PS2 - My third console. The last time I counted, I owned 80+ games for this console, but I'm not sure what the total is. Favorite games include MGS3, GT4, T5, MKD, FFX and many more.
360 - My fourth and current console. Own a few games for it; Forza 2, Viva Pinata(bundled, and I'm kinda glad it was), Mass Effect, Skate, GTAIV, FIFA 08 and Oblivion. Got it in January.

Honorary mentions:
Genesis/Mega-Drive - A memory dimmer than the C64, I can't remember much more than Sonic. Good console, but I'd rather have my NES.
Gamecube - My brothers trusty old gamecube is still going strong, to the point that I've almost become indifferent to Mario as a game character.
PS3 - Haven't played a lot, I think it has the potential to be great, but Sony keeps dropping the ball. There's something odd about the controller too...
PC - Until a few years ago, I held my PC in higher regard than any platform, mostly because I really like to mess with games... but then windows deleted itself and I'm computerless...

So, that's it. I started out as a Nintendo fanboy, I turned to Sony for two generations and now I'm with Microsoft. Next generation depends on the consoles, which is why I wait for at least 6 months before I buy.
